From 46b726eaab751669726895f6f5fa30095b062e80 Mon Sep 17 00:00:00 2001 From: Marcoen Hirschberg Date: Wed, 7 Dec 2005 08:37:14 +0000 Subject: several small fixes sugested by different people (FireFly, Lear, Takka) git-svn-id: svn://svn.rockbox.org/rockbox/trunk@8184 a1c6a512-1295-4272-9138-f99709370657 --- apps/bookmark.c | 4 +--- firmware/common/unicode.c | 2 +- firmware/mpeg.c | 7 +++---- tools/buildzip.pl | 4 ---- 4 files changed, 5 insertions(+), 12 deletions(-) diff --git a/apps/bookmark.c b/apps/bookmark.c index 8980e4fc26..ce82f77742 100644 --- a/apps/bookmark.c +++ b/apps/bookmark.c @@ -207,9 +207,7 @@ bool bookmark_autobookmark(void) return write_bookmark(false); } #ifdef HAVE_LCD_BITMAP - unsigned char *lines[]={str(LANG_AUTO_BOOKMARK_QUERY), - str(LANG_CONFIRM_WITH_PLAY_RECORDER), - str(LANG_CANCEL_WITH_ANY_RECORDER)}; + unsigned char *lines[]={str(LANG_AUTO_BOOKMARK_QUERY); struct text_message message={(char **)lines, 3}; #else unsigned char *lines[]={str(LANG_AUTO_BOOKMARK_QUERY), diff --git a/firmware/common/unicode.c b/firmware/common/unicode.c index 4e1b78f9e1..e2e2dc2f3a 100644 --- a/firmware/common/unicode.c +++ b/firmware/common/unicode.c @@ -92,7 +92,7 @@ unsigned char* utf8encode(unsigned long ucs, unsigned char *utf8) int tail = 0; if (ucs > 0x7F) - while (ucs >> (6*tail + 2)) + while (ucs >> (5*tail + 6)) tail++; *utf8++ = (ucs >> (6*tail)) | utf8comp[tail]; diff --git a/firmware/mpeg.c b/firmware/mpeg.c index b5f1ef83c7..5b1a543f2d 100644 --- a/firmware/mpeg.c +++ b/firmware/mpeg.c @@ -920,10 +920,9 @@ static struct trackdata *add_track_to_tag_list(const char *filename) track->mempos = audiobuf_write; track->id3.elapsed = 0; #ifdef HAVE_LCD_BITMAP - int w, h; - lcd_getstringsize(track->id3.title, &w, &h); - lcd_getstringsize(track->id3.artist, &w, &h); - lcd_getstringsize(track->id3.album, &w, &h); + lcd_getstringsize(track->id3.title, NULL, NULL); + lcd_getstringsize(track->id3.artist, NULL, NULL); + lcd_getstringsize(track->id3.album, NULL, NULL); #endif track_write_idx = (track_write_idx+1) & MAX_TRACK_ENTRIES_MASK; diff --git a/tools/buildzip.pl b/tools/buildzip.pl index 57ffbdf749..1942071565 100755 --- a/tools/buildzip.pl +++ b/tools/buildzip.pl @@ -78,10 +78,6 @@ sub buildzip { # no codec was copied, remove directory again rmdir(".rockbox/codecs"); - system("$ROOT/tools/codepages"); - my $c = 'find . -name "*.cp" ! -empty -exec mv {} .rockbox/codepages/ \; >/dev/null 2>&1'; - print `$c`; - } -- cgit v1.2.3